sql 多条件组合查询,并根据指定类别找出所有最
假设提供的文章为:
神秘的自然奇迹——黄果树瀑布
在中国的西南部,有一个地方名为贵州,这里隐藏着大自然的神秘杰作——黄果树瀑布。这是一个令人叹为观止的自然景观,每年都吸引着成千上万的游客前来探访。今天,让我们一同走进这个美丽的画卷,感受大自然的神奇魅力。
黄果树瀑布,是大自然的杰作,也是中国最大的瀑布之一。它的壮观景象令人震撼,仿佛从天而降的巨大白色绸带,从高处倾泻而下,发出雷鸣般的轰鸣声。站在观景台上,你可以感受到瀑布带来的清凉水雾,仿佛身处仙境。
沿着小路漫步,你可以欣赏到瀑布周围的美丽景色。绿树成荫,花香扑鼻,仿佛置身于一个天然的大氧吧。黄果树瀑布的瀑布群,由多个瀑布组成,每个瀑布都有自己独特的形态和风格。其中,最壮观的主瀑布高达77.8米,犹如一条巨龙从山间腾空而出。
除了观赏瀑布,你还可以在这里体验各种户外活动。乘坐缆车穿越山谷,感受瀑布的壮观景象;沿着悬崖步道行走,挑战自己的勇气和胆识;在瀑布下的水池里嬉戏玩耍,享受清凉的水雾和宁静的氛围。这里还有丰富的民族文化活动,让你感受到贵州独特的民俗文化魅力。
黄果树瀑布是一个充满魅力的地方,它展现了大自然的神奇和美丽。来到这里,你可以感受到大自然的独特魅力,也可以放松身心,享受美好的时光。如果你还没有来过这里,不妨抽个时间来这里一竟,感受大自然的神奇魅力吧!
贵州的明珠——黄果树瀑布
在贵州这片神奇的土地上,隐藏着一个自然造就的绝美奇迹——黄果树瀑布。这个令人心驰神往的地方每年都吸引着无数游客前来探访,感受大自然的壮丽景色。今天,让我们一同走进这幅美丽的画卷,领略大自然的神奇魅力。
黄果树瀑布是大自然赠予的瑰宝,也是中国最大的瀑布之一。它犹如一条从天而降的白色绸带,以雷霆万钧之势从高处倾泻而下,发出震耳欲聋的轰鸣声。站在观景台上,你可以感受到瀑布带来的清凉水雾和扑面而来的水汽,仿佛置身于仙境之中。
漫步在瀑布周围的林间小道上,你可以欣赏到瀑布群的多姿多彩。绿树成荫、花香四溢的环境仿佛是一个天然的大氧吧。其中最为壮观的主瀑布高达77.8米,宛如一条巨龙从山间腾空而起,让人惊叹不已。
在这里,你还可以参与各种户外活动,感受瀑布的壮美。乘坐缆车穿越山谷,让你从高空俯瞰瀑布的壮观景象;沿着悬崖步道行走,挑战自己的勇气和胆识;在瀑布下的水池里嬉戏玩耍,享受清凉的水雾和宁静的氛围。你还可以领略到丰富多彩的民族文化活动,感受贵州独特的民俗魅力。
在数据库查询中,我们经常需要根据多个条件进行组合查询,并找出特定类别下的所有最小子类。以下是一个基于SQL的示例代码,展示了如何完成这样的任务。
我们定义了一些变量来存储查询中的参数,如页面大小(`@PAGESIZE`)、页码(`@PAGEINDEX`)等。然后,我们有一个游标(`ABC`),用于遍历查询条件。这些条件可能包括字段名(`FIELDNAME`)、字段值(`FIELDVALUE`)和操作类型(如 `Like` 或其他比较操作)。
在这个过程中,我们构建了一个动态SQL查询字符串(`@WHERE`),用于过滤结果集。如果字段操作是 `Like`,则会在查询中加入模糊匹配的条件。对于特定的字段名(如 `CLASSID`),我们需要找到其子类并加入到临时表(`TBTEMCLASS`)中。为了实现这一点,我们使用了另一个游标(`CLASSID`)来遍历临时表,并将子类加入其中。我们将当前类别从临时表中删除,以避免重复处理。我们将自身类别也加入到临时表中。
接下来,我们构建了一个计数语句来统计满足条件的结果数量。然后,我们根据结果数量和页面大小计算总页数。
然后,我们构建了主要的查询语句(`@SQL`),用于从数据库中获取数据。根据页码的不同,我们构建不同的查询条件。如果是第一页,则直接获取前N条记录;否则,我们通过子查询找到已存在的记录,并从结果集中排除这些记录,以获取新的数据。
我们执行查询并将结果放入临时表(`TBTEMINFO`)。然后,我们使用游标遍历临时表,为每个记录找到其所属的类别路径(`NS`)和(`DS`)。这些路径和信息被更新回临时表。我们从临时表中查询结果并清空临时表。
整个过程充分利用了SQL的动态性和灵活性,能够根据用户的需求进行复杂的查询操作。通过游标和临时表的使用,我们能够处理复杂的数据结构和关系,提取出用户需要的信息。这种技术对于处理大型数据库和复杂查询场景非常有效。
注意:以上代码仅为示例,实际使用时需要根据具体的数据库结构和需求进行调整。为了安全性和性能考虑,建议在实际环境中仔细测试和评估代码。
编程语言
- sql 多条件组合查询,并根据指定类别找出所有最
- 利用promise及参数解构封装ajax请求的方法
- laravel http 自定义公共验证和响应的方法
- 对VUE中的对象添加属性
- vue展示dicom文件医疗系统的实现代码
- 正则表达式提取img的src
- 9个让JavaScript调试更简单的Console命令
- 如何使用php生成zip压缩包
- PHP中的错误及其处理机制
- ASP 改良版MD5、SHA256多重加密类(二次及多次)
- php实现用户登陆简单实例
- javascript回调函数详解
- jQuery插件FusionCharts实现的2D饼状图效果【附demo源
- 简单的php新闻发布系统教程
- Vue三种常用传值示例(父传子、子传父、非父子
- 基于Vue,Nginx的前后端不分离部署教程